Understanding the Difference Between Sanitizing and Sterilizing

Sanitizing reduces the number of germs on surfaces to safe levels, while sterilizing kills all microorganisms, including spores. Both processes are important in a daycare setting, but sterilization is especially crucial for toys that children put in their mouths or that are used by multiple children.

Steps to Sanitize Toys in Sarasota Daycare Centers

Follow these steps regularly to keep toys clean:

  • Wash toys with warm, soapy water to remove dirt and residue.
  • Rinse thoroughly to eliminate soap traces.
  • Use a disinfectant approved for childcare settings, following the manufacturer’s instructions.
  • Allow toys to air dry completely before returning them to play areas.

Additional Tips for Sarasota Daycare Centers

To maintain a safe environment, consider the following tips:

  • Establish a regular cleaning schedule, especially during flu season.
  • Train staff on proper cleaning and sterilization techniques.
  • Use toys that are dishwasher safe for easy sterilization.
  • Inspect toys regularly for damage and replace worn or broken items.
